Large Clay Chimineas For Sale

Chimineas made of clay need to be protected from the elements. If left exposed to rain and cold a clay chiminea can be softer or break.

bali-outdoors-fire-pit-wood-burning-chiminea-outside-fireplace-patio-small-firepit-size-17-7-w-x-35-6-h-brown-black-3554.jpgChimineas that are regularly used should be filled with 50mm of sand or Gardeco lava stones (see Accessories above). This will reduce contact between the chiminea and the direct flames. It also assists the clay material be used to generate heat in a staggered manner.

Maintenance

Chimineas are made from clay, which is susceptible to cracking. This is a minor problem, but it could have a negative impact on the appearance and functionality. To avoid this from happening, it is essential to keep your chiminea in good condition. Cleaning it frequently and sealing it with sealant is a part of this. It is also important to properly store your chiminea to prevent damage from extreme temperatures and moisture.

One of the main reasons for cracks in a chiminea is careless handling. Be careful when handling a chiminea, as it is a large piece fine china. Avoid dropping it, not letting it touch anything that could ignite or fire it when it is hot. A dealer once told me he couldn't even warrant his chimineas against breakage since they were most likely to break due to careless handling before they had been fired up once!

Another common cause of cracks on chimineas is using water to smother the fire. Clay is susceptible to sudden temperature changes, and pouring hot water onto a clay chiminea can cause thermal shock and stress cracks. The best way to put out the chiminea is to let the fire die naturally, or to make use of sand to put it out in a safe manner.

It is essential to purchase a chiminea that comes with an base. It will be easier to clean and will make it more attractive in your backyard. Chimineas with no stands can be difficult to move, especially when it's windy or rainy. You should also purchase an instrument to help move the logs and a brush to get rid of the ash and soot.

You should "cure" (break in) your terracotta chiminea slowly as you first purchase it. Start with small fires and gradually increase the size of your logs. During this time the clay will get more resistant to cracks and seasoned. A seasoned chiminea will also be more efficient in holding a larger, well-controlled fire. After three or four small flames, you will be capable of starting a large fire with confidence. It is crucial to keep an watch on the size of the fire to ensure that it doesn't get out of hand.
